CPU comparisonAMD Ryzen Embedded R1102G or Intel Core i9-14900F -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The AMD Ryzen Embedded R1102G has 2 cores with 2 threads and clocks with a maximum frequency of 2.60 GHz. Up to 32 GB of memory is supported in 2 memory channels. The AMD Ryzen Embedded R1102G was released in Q1/2020. The Intel Core i9-14900F has 24 cores with 32 threads and clocks with a maximum frequency of 5.80 GHz. The CPU supports up to 192 GB of memory in 2 memory channels. The Intel Core i9-14900F was released in Q1/2024. |

CPU Cores and Base FrequencyThe AMD Ryzen Embedded R1102G is a 2 core processor with a clock frequency of 1.20 GHz (2.60 GHz). The Intel Core i9-14900F has 24 CPU cores with a clock frequency of 2.00 GHz (5.80 GHz). |

Thermal ManagementThe TDP (Thermal Design Power) of a processor specifies the required cooling solution. The AMD Ryzen Embedded R1102G has a TDP of 6 W, that of the Intel Core i9-14900F is 65 W. |
